JUST IN: Court of Appeal reinstates all PDP candidates in Ogun

  The Court of Appeal sitting in Ibadan the Oyo State capital has set aside a judgment of the Federal High Court, Abeokuta, Ogun State, that sacked all candidates of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in Ogun state and ordering fresh primary elections. Yobe North: Senate President loses at Appeal Court

  The Senate President, Ahmed Lawan, has lost his bid for a re-election, as the Court of Appeal sitting in Abuja, on Monday, affirmed Bashir Machina as the authentic candidate of the All Progressives Congress (APC) for the 2023 Yobe North Senatorial District election. Qatar 2022: Cameroon, Serbia share thrilling 3-3 draw

  Cameroon kept their hopes alive of reaching the World Cup last 16 after battling back from two goals down to draw a six-goal thriller with Serbia in Group G. Cryptocurrency co-founder, Tiantian Kullander, dies ‘unexpectedly’ aged 30

  The co-founder of a cryptocurrency company has died ‘unexpectedly’ at the age of 30. Tiantian Kullander, who co-founded the Hong Kong-digital asset company Amber Group, passed away in his sleep, a spokesman for his firm said. Somali forces battle jihadists in hotel siege

  Somali forces are battling to regain control of a hotel seized by militants in the centre of the capital, Mogadishu, on Sunday evening. JUST IN: Nigeria issues travel advisory on US, UK 

*Tells citizens to be on the alert The Federal Government has issued a travel advisory to its citizens travelling to the United States and the United Kingdom following recent reports of theft of international passports and other belongings of Nigerians travelling to these countries.
